Maintenance jobs in Inverness
Maintenance encompasses various tasks necessary to ensure equipment, buildings, and systems operate efficiently and remain in good condition. Technicians conduct inspections, repairs, and replacements to keep everything functioning smoothly. Those in maintenance roles often possess skills in problem-solving, technical abilities, and attention to detail.

Mechanics inspect, diagnose, and repair vehicle systems to ensure safety and performance. They need technical expertise in engine and brake systems, strong problem-solving skills, and knowledge of automotive tools and safety standards.

Operators control and monitor machinery to ensure smooth production, respond promptly to issues, and maintain safety standards. They need mechanical aptitude, knowledge of operational protocols, and effective communication skills to coordinate within teams.

Tire Technicians fit, repair, and balance tyres, ensuring vehicle safety and performance. They need mechanical aptitude, knowledge of tyre types and regulations, and proficiency in using diagnostic and fitting equipment for accurate service delivery.

Fitters assemble, install, and maintain machinery or structural components, ensuring accurate alignment and secure fitting. They need proficiency in interpreting technical drawings, practical mechanical skills, and knowledge of safety procedures within industrial settings.

Electricians install and maintain electrical systems, diagnose issues, and ensure safety standards. They need expertise in wiring and circuit design, knowledge of building regulations, and practical problem-solving skills.
